/** Identifier type */
class IdType : public Type
{
public:
/** Constructor
* @param size Number of values in the identifier pool
*/
IdType (card_t size) : Type (false), mySize (size) {}
/** Copy constructor */
IdType (const class IdType& old) : Type (old), mySize (old.mySize) {}
private:
/** Assignment operator */
class IdType& operator= (const class IdType& old);
public:
/** Destructor */
~IdType () {}
/** Copy the Type */
class Type* copy () const { return new class IdType (*this); }
/** Determine the kind of the type */
enum Kind getKind () const { return tId; }
/** Get the first value of this type */
class Value& getFirstValue () const;
/** Get the last value of this type */
class Value& getLastValue () const;
/** Determine the number of values in the identifier pool */
card_t getSize () const { return mySize; }
/** Convert a value of this type to a number
* @param value value to be converted
* @return number between 0 and getNumValues () - 1
*/
card_t convert (const class Value& value) const;
/** Convert a number to a value of this type
* @param number number between 0 and getNumValues () - 1
* @return the corresponding value
*/
class Value* convert (card_t number) const;
/** See if the type is assignable to another type
* @param type the type this type should be assignable to
* @return true if this type is assignable to the type
*/
bool isAssignable (const class Type& type) const { return &type == this; }
/** Get the number of possible values for this type */
card_t do_getNumValues () const;
# ifdef EXPR_COMPILE
/** Generate a C type declaration
* @param out output stream for the declarations
* @param indent indentation level
*/
void compileDefinition (class StringBuffer& out,
unsigned indent) const;
/** Emit code for converting an unconstrained value to a number
* @param out output stream
* @param indent indentation level
* @param value value to be converted
* @param number number to be computed
* @param add flag: add to number instead of assigning
*/
void do_compileConversion (class StringBuffer& out,
unsigned indent,
const char* value,
const char* number,
bool add) const;
# endif // EXPR_COMPILE
/** Display the type definition
* @param printer the printer object
*/
void display (const class Printer& printer) const;
private:
/** Number of values in the identifier pool */
const card_t mySize;
};
